1969 Palm Beach Pop Festival Documentary Trailer. A three Day rock festival the local news called "Woodstock South", and the political complications that include the Churches, Sheriff, Zoning Commission, and Governor. All theses forces and more tried to stop this festival. The Performers were The Rolling Stones, Janis Joplin, Jefferson Airplane, Johnny Winter, Sweetwater, Country Joe and The Fish, Rotary Connection, Grand Funk Railroad, King Crimson, Spirit, The Byrds, PG&E, Sly and The Family Stone, Steppenwolf, Bethlehem Asylum, plus many more
